Painting Description
"Etude D'hommes Et De Femmes Priant" is a notable work by the French painter Jean II Restout, who was an influential figure in the 18th-century French art scene. Born in 1692, Restout was part of a prominent family of artists and was known for his religious and historical paintings, which often depicted dramatic and emotional scenes. His works are characterized by their meticulous attention to detail, expressive figures, and masterful use of light and shadow.
"Etude D'hommes Et De Femmes Priant," which translates to "Study of Men and Women Praying," is a compelling example of Restout's skill in capturing human emotion and spirituality. The painting portrays a group of men and women deeply engrossed in prayer, their faces and postures reflecting a range of emotions from solemnity to fervent devotion. The composition is carefully arranged to draw the viewer's eye towards the central figures, creating a sense of intimacy and immediacy.
Restout's use of chiaroscuro in this work is particularly noteworthy. The dramatic contrasts between light and dark areas not only enhance the three-dimensionality of the figures but also imbue the scene with a sense of divine presence. The soft, diffused light that illuminates the praying figures suggests a spiritual or heavenly source, reinforcing the painting's religious theme.
The artist's attention to detail is evident in the intricate rendering of the clothing and the subtle variations in the expressions and gestures of the figures. Each individual is depicted with a unique personality and emotional state, contributing to the overall narrative of collective piety and individual devotion.
"Etude D'hommes Et De Femmes Priant" exemplifies Jean II Restout's ability to convey complex human emotions and spiritual experiences through his art. It remains a significant piece within his oeuvre and a testament to his contributions to the religious art of his time.
